Top 100 MCP Servers You Can Connect to Now: The Ultimate Guide
Introduction: Unlocking AI's Full Potential with MCP
The Model Context Protocol (MCP) is revolutionizing how AI assistants interact with external tools, data sources, and services. By establishing a standardized communication framework, MCP enables large language models to securely access everything from databases and file systems to web browsers and cloud services. This technological breakthrough transforms AI assistants from simple text generators into powerful agents that can execute real-world tasks with precision and security.
As the MCP ecosystem rapidly expands, developers and organizations are releasing an impressive array of specialized servers that extend AI capabilities in countless ways. This comprehensive guide explores the top 100 MCP servers available today, organized by category, with direct GitHub links to help you implement these powerful tools immediately. You can check out 1000+ MCP Servers at HiMCP (opens in a new tab):
https://himcp.ai (opens in a new tab)
What Makes MCP Servers Revolutionary?
MCP servers act as bridges between AI models and external systems, providing standardized interfaces for accessing data and executing operations. Unlike traditional APIs that require custom integration for each service, MCP offers a universal protocol that AI models can discover and utilize dynamically. This allows language models to:
- Access real-time data beyond their training cutoff
- Execute operations in external systems through natural language requests
- Maintain context across complex multi-step workflows
- Interact securely with sensitive systems through controlled permissions
Whether you're using Claude Desktop, Cursor, VS Code, or other MCP-compatible clients, these servers can dramatically enhance your AI workflows. Let's explore the extensive MCP ecosystem.
Data Access and Storage Solutions
Databases That Speak MCP
Database MCP servers provide secure, structured data access with powerful query capabilities:
-
PostgreSQL Integration - Full database access with schema inspection and query execution GitHub: modelcontextprotocol/server-postgres (opens in a new tab)
-
SQLite Operations - Lightweight database integration with built-in analysis tools GitHub: modelcontextprotocol/server-sqlite (opens in a new tab)
-
MongoDB Lens - Comprehensive MongoDB database operations GitHub: furey/mongodb-lens (opens in a new tab)
-
Neo4j Graph Database - Graph database with knowledge graph capabilities GitHub: neo4j-contrib/mcp-neo4j (opens in a new tab)
-
Neon Serverless Postgres - Cloud-optimized PostgreSQL management GitHub: neondatabase/mcp-server-neon (opens in a new tab)
-
ClickHouse Analytics - High-performance columnar database integration GitHub: ClickHouse/mcp-clickhouse (opens in a new tab)
-
Vector Search with Qdrant - Vector database for semantic search applications GitHub: qdrant/mcp-server-qdrant (opens in a new tab)
-
Universal Database Hub - Connect to multiple database types through a single interface GitHub: bytebase/dbhub (opens in a new tab)
-
Milvus Vector Database - Specialized vector database for AI embeddings GitHub: zilliztech/mcp-server-milvus (opens in a new tab)
-
Supabase Integration - PostgreSQL-based platform with additional features GitHub: alexanderzuev/supabase-mcp-server (opens in a new tab)
File Systems and Storage
These servers provide secure, managed access to local and cloud-based file systems:
-
Local Filesystem Access - Direct file system operations with security controls GitHub: modelcontextprotocol/server-filesystem (opens in a new tab)
-
Google Drive Integration - Cloud storage management and search GitHub: modelcontextprotocol/server-google-drive (opens in a new tab)
-
Box Enterprise Content - Enterprise content management integration GitHub: hmk/box-mcp-server (opens in a new tab)
-
Fast Windows File Search - Lightning-fast file search using Everything SDK GitHub: mamertofabian/mcp-everything-search (opens in a new tab)
-
Cloud Storage with OpenDAL - Access any storage service through Apache OpenDAL GitHub: Xuanwo/mcp-server-opendal (opens in a new tab)
Web and Browser Automation
Browser Control and Web Access
These servers enable AI to navigate and extract data from websites:
-
Puppeteer Browser Automation - Control headless browsers for web scraping and testing GitHub: modelcontextprotocol/server-puppeteer (opens in a new tab)
-
Playwright MCP Server - Microsoft's powerful browser automation framework GitHub: microsoft/playwright-mcp (opens in a new tab)
-
Browserbase Automation - Cloud-based browser interactions for data extraction GitHub: browserbase/mcp-server-browserbase (opens in a new tab)
-
Firefox Browser Control - Control Firefox through browser extensions GitHub: eyalzh/browser-control-mcp (opens in a new tab)
-
Web Content Fetching - Efficient web content retrieval and processing GitHub: modelcontextprotocol/server-fetch (opens in a new tab)
Search and Information Retrieval
These servers help AI find relevant information across the web:
-
Brave Search - Web search capabilities using Brave's Search API GitHub: modelcontextprotocol/server-brave-search (opens in a new tab)
-
Exa AI Search - AI-optimized search built for LLM integration GitHub: exa-labs/exa-mcp-server (opens in a new tab)
-
Google Search Alternative - Free web searching using Google search results GitHub: pskill9/web-search (opens in a new tab)
-
SearXNG Privacy-Focused Search - Self-hosted private web search GitHub: Ihor-Sokoliuk/MCP-SearXNG (opens in a new tab)
-
DuckDuckGo Search - Privacy-oriented web search integration GitHub: nickclyde/duckduckgo-mcp-server (opens in a new tab)
-
Kagi Search API - Professional search engine with premium features GitHub: ac3xx/mcp-servers-kagi (opens in a new tab)
Cloud and Infrastructure Management
Cloud Platform Integration
Connect AI to major cloud providers for resource management:
-
AWS Resources Operations - Manage AWS services and infrastructure GitHub: alexei-led/aws-mcp-server (opens in a new tab)
-
Kubernetes Cluster Management - Control Kubernetes clusters and workloads GitHub: rohitg00/kubectl-mcp-server (opens in a new tab)
-
Cloudflare Integration - Deploy and manage Cloudflare resources GitHub: cloudflare/mcp-server-cloudflare (opens in a new tab)
-
Azure CLI Integration - Direct interface to Azure cloud services GitHub: jdubois/azure-cli-mcp (opens in a new tab)
-
Multi-Cluster Kubernetes - Advanced multi-cluster management capabilities GitHub: weibaohui/k8m (opens in a new tab)
-
Docker Container Management - Control Docker containers and images GitHub: QuantGeekDev/docker-mcp (opens in a new tab)
Developer Tools and Productivity
Code and Terminal Integration
These servers enhance coding workflows and terminal operations:
-
Command Line Interface - Secure command execution and terminal control GitHub: MladenSU/cli-mcp-server (opens in a new tab)
-
iTerm2 Integration - Control and interact with the macOS terminal GitHub: ferrislucas/iterm-mcp (opens in a new tab)
-
Git Repository Operations - Git version control system integration GitHub: modelcontextprotocol/server-git (opens in a new tab)
-
GitHub API Integration - Repository management, PRs, issues, and more GitHub: modelcontextprotocol/server-github (opens in a new tab)
-
GitLab Integration - GitLab project management and CI/CD operations GitHub: modelcontextprotocol/server-gitlab (opens in a new tab)
-
VS Code Integration - JetBrains IDE connection for enhanced coding GitHub: jetbrains/mcpProxy (opens in a new tab)
-
Python Code Execution - Safe Python interpreter for code execution GitHub: pydantic/pydantic-ai/mcp-run-python (opens in a new tab)
-
Excel Manipulation - Comprehensive Excel operations and formatting GitHub: haris-musa/excel-mcp-server (opens in a new tab)
Project Management and Documentation
Servers for managing tasks, documents, and workflows:
-
Notion Integration - Connect to Notion workspaces and databases GitHub: suekou/mcp-notion-server (opens in a new tab)
-
Obsidian Notes - Access and search Markdown notes and knowledge bases GitHub: calclavia/mcp-obsidian (opens in a new tab)
-
Jira Integration - Project and issue tracking with Atlassian's Jira GitHub: KS-GEN-AI/jira-mcp-server (opens in a new tab)
-
Confluence Integration - Access Confluence documents and spaces GitHub: KS-GEN-AI/confluence-mcp-server (opens in a new tab)
-
Linear Project Management - Task and issue management with Linear GitHub: tacticlaunch/mcp-linear (opens in a new tab)
Communication and Messaging
Communication Platform Integration
Connect AI to messaging and communication systems:
-
Slack Workspace Integration - Channel management and messaging GitHub: modelcontextprotocol/server-slack (opens in a new tab)
-
iMessage Access - Query and analyze iMessage conversations GitHub: carterlasalle/mac_messages_mcp (opens in a new tab)
-
WhatsApp Integration - Search and send WhatsApp messages GitHub: lharries/whatsapp-mcp (opens in a new tab)
-
Telegram Access - Interact with Telegram messages and channels [GitHub mentioned in list but link not provided directly]
-
Gmail Integration - Email management and processing GitHub: elie222/inbox-zero (opens in a new tab)
Knowledge and Memory Systems
Persistent Memory and Knowledge
These servers enable AI to maintain context across sessions:
-
Knowledge Graph Memory - Persistent memory system across conversations GitHub: modelcontextprotocol/server-memory (opens in a new tab)
-
Enhanced Graph Memory - Role-play and storytelling focused memory GitHub: CheMiguel23/MemoryMesh (opens in a new tab)
-
RAG Documents - Vector search for documentation retrieval GitHub: hannesrudolph/mcp-ragdocs (opens in a new tab)
-
Zotero Integration - Access academic reference collections GitHub: kaliaboi/mcp-zotero (opens in a new tab)
Location and Maps Services
Geographic and Location Data
Access location-based information and services:
-
Google Maps Integration - Location services, routing, and place details GitHub: modelcontextprotocol/server-google-maps (opens in a new tab)
-
OpenStreetMap Access - Open-source mapping and location data GitHub: jagan-shanmugam/open-streetmap-mcp (opens in a new tab)
-
IP Geolocation - Location information from IP addresses GitHub: briandconnelly/mcp-server-ipinfo (opens in a new tab)
-
Weather Information - Current and forecast weather data GitHub: SaintDoresh/Weather-MCP-ClaudeDesktop (opens in a new tab)
-
Time Zone Utilities - Time conversion across time zones GitHub: SecretiveShell/MCP-timeserver (opens in a new tab)
Finance and Blockchain
Financial Data and Operations
Connect AI to financial systems and markets:
-
Stripe Integration - Payment processing and customer management GitHub: modelcontextprotocol/servers/tree/main/src/stripe (opens in a new tab)
-
Cryptocurrency Data - Market information for cryptocurrencies GitHub: narumiruna/yfinance-mcp (opens in a new tab)
-
Stock Market API - Financial market data and analytics GitHub: SaintDoresh/YFinance-Trader-MCP-ClaudeDesktop (opens in a new tab)
-
EVM Blockchain Integration - Comprehensive blockchain services GitHub: mcpdotdirect/evm-mcp-server (opens in a new tab)
-
Crypto Fear & Greed Index - Market sentiment tracking for crypto GitHub: kukapay/crypto-feargreed-mcp (opens in a new tab)
-
Bitcoin Protocol Interaction - Direct Bitcoin blockchain access GitHub: AbdelStark/bitcoin-mcp (opens in a new tab)
Monitoring and Analytics
System Monitoring and Error Tracking
Track application performance and errors:
-
Grafana Dashboard - Search and query Grafana metrics and dashboards GitHub: grafana/mcp-grafana (opens in a new tab)
-
Sentry Error Tracking - Monitor application errors and performance GitHub: modelcontextprotocol/server-sentry (opens in a new tab)
-
Raygun Integration - Crash reporting and real user monitoring GitHub: modelcontextprotocol/server-raygun (opens in a new tab)
-
Prometheus Monitoring - Open-source metrics and alerting system GitHub: pab1it0/prometheus-mcp-server (opens in a new tab)
-
System Monitoring - Real-time system metrics tracking GitHub: seekrays/mcp-monitor (opens in a new tab)
Smart Home and IoT
Home Automation and Control
Integrate AI with smart home systems:
-
Home Assistant Control - Manage smart home devices and automations GitHub: allenporter/mcp-server-home-assistant (opens in a new tab)
-
Apple Shortcuts - Trigger Apple Shortcuts automations GitHub: recursechat/mcp-server-apple-shortcuts (opens in a new tab)
-
Apple Reminders - Manage tasks with Apple's Reminders app GitHub: fradser/mcp-server-apple-reminders (opens in a new tab)
Security and Analysis
Security Tools and Integrations
Enhance security operations with AI:
-
Semgrep Integration - Code security scanning and vulnerability detection GitHub: semgrep/mcp-security-audit (opens in a new tab)
-
VirusTotal Integration - File and URL security scanning GitHub: BurtTheCoder/mcp-virustotal (opens in a new tab)
-
Shodan Security Scanning - Internet-connected device security analysis GitHub: BurtTheCoder/mcp-shodan (opens in a new tab)
-
IDA Pro Integration - Professional binary analysis tools GitHub: mrexodia/ida-pro-mcp (opens in a new tab)
-
Ghidra Integration - NSA reverse engineering framework GitHub: 13bm/GhidraMCP (opens in a new tab)
Art and Media
Content Creation and Management
Access and create visual and audio content:
-
Video Editing with DaVinci Resolve - Professional video editing tools GitHub: samuelgursky/davinci-resolve-mcp (opens in a new tab)
-
Image Generation via Replicate - AI image creation with Replicate GitHub: awkoy/replicate-flux-mcp (opens in a new tab)
-
VegaLite Visualizations - Data visualization generation GitHub: isaacwasserman/mcp-vegalite-server (opens in a new tab)
-
Animation with Manim - Mathematical animation generation GitHub: abhiemj/manim-mcp-server (opens in a new tab)
-
Mindmap Generation - Create interactive mindmaps from text GitHub: YuChenSSR/mindmap-mcp-server (opens in a new tab)
-
Spotify Control - Music playback and playlist management GitHub: marcelmarais/spotify-mcp-server (opens in a new tab)
-
Unsplash Image Search - High-quality free image access GitHub: hellokaton/unsplash-mcp-server (opens in a new tab)
Gaming and Interactive Media
Game Development and Integration
Connect AI to gaming platforms and engines:
-
Unity Game Engine - Game development with Unity GitHub: CoderGamester/mcp-unity (opens in a new tab)
-
Godot Game Engine - Open-source game development with Godot GitHub: Coding-Solo/godot-mcp (opens in a new tab)
-
VRChat Integration - Virtual reality social platform access GitHub: sawa-zen/vrchat-mcp (opens in a new tab)
Language Models and AI Integration
AI Platform Connections
Connect AI assistants to other AI services:
-
OpenAI API Integration - Access OpenAI models from Claude GitHub: pierrebrunelle/mcp-server-openai (opens in a new tab)
-
OpenAI Assistant Integration - Use OpenAI assistants as tools GitHub: andybrandt/mcp-simple-openai-assistant (opens in a new tab)
-
Perplexity Integration - Connect to Perplexity's search API GitHub: tanigami/mcp-server-perplexity (opens in a new tab)
-
HuggingFace Spaces - Use models from HuggingFace directly GitHub: llmindset/mcp-hfspace (opens in a new tab)
Multi-Tool Integrations
Aggregator and Workflow Platforms
Access multiple tools through unified interfaces:
-
Pipedream Integration - Connect with 2,500+ APIs and tools GitHub: PipedreamHQ/pipedream (opens in a new tab)
-
Make Platform Integration - Turn Make scenarios into AI tools GitHub: makehq/mcp-server (opens in a new tab)
-
Zapier Integration - Connect to thousands of apps through Zapier [GitHub mentioned in list but direct link not provided]
-
Multi-AI Advisor - Query multiple models for diverse perspectives GitHub: YuChenSSR/multi-ai-advisor (opens in a new tab)
Specialized Tools
Unique and Niche Functionality
Enhance AI with specialized capabilities:
-
Pandoc Document Conversion - Convert between document formats GitHub: vivekvells/mcp-pandoc (opens in a new tab)
-
Markdownify Content Conversion - Convert various formats to Markdown GitHub: zcaceres/markdownify-mcp (opens in a new tab)
-
Image Compression - Optimize and compress images locally GitHub: InhiblabCore/mcp-image-compression (opens in a new tab)
-
Rijksmuseum Art API - Access artwork from the Dutch national museum GitHub: r-huijts/rijksmuseum-mcp (opens in a new tab)
How to Connect to MCP Servers
Connecting to MCP servers is straightforward with MCP-compatible clients like Claude Desktop, Cursor, VS Code with Copilot, or other AI tools that implement the protocol.
Step-by-Step Integration with Claude Desktop
-
Install the MCP server of your choice using one of these methods:
- Direct installation:
npm install -g [server-package]
orpip install [server-package]
- Using Smithery:
npx -y @smithery/cli install [server-name] --client claude
- Manual installation from source repositories
- Direct installation:
-
Configure Claude Desktop by editing the configuration file:
- macOS:
~/Library/Application\ Support/Claude/claude_desktop_config.json
- Windows:
%APPDATA%/Claude/claude_desktop_config.json
- macOS:
-
Add server configuration to the
mcpServers
section:
{
"mcpServers": {
"example-server": {
"command": "npx",
"args": ["-y", "example-mcp-server"],
"env": {
"API_KEY": "your-api-key",
"CONFIG_OPTION": "value"
}
}
}
}
-
Restart your client to load the new MCP server configuration
-
Verify connection by asking your AI assistant to use the newly connected tools
Connecting to Multiple Servers
You can connect to multiple MCP servers simultaneously by adding multiple entries to your configuration file:
{
"mcpServers": {
"database": {
"command": "npx",
"args": ["-y", "@modelcontextprotocol/server-postgres"],
"env": {
"DATABASE_URL": "postgresql://localhost/mydb"
}
},
"filesystem": {
"command": "npx",
"args": ["-y", "@modelcontextprotocol/server-filesystem", "/path/to/allowed/files"],
"env": {}
},
"browser": {
"command": "npx",
"args": ["-y", "@modelcontextprotocol/server-puppeteer"],
"env": {}
}
}
}
Advanced MCP Integration Tips
Security Best Practices
When working with MCP servers, follow these security guidelines:
- Use read-only modes when possible to prevent unintended modifications
- Limit access scopes for servers that connect to sensitive systems
- Regularly rotate API keys used in MCP server configurations
- Configure allowlists for operations or resources when available
- Never share configuration files containing API keys or credentials
Developing Custom MCP Servers
Want to create your own MCP server? Several frameworks can streamline development:
- FastMCP - High-level framework for Python
- LiteMCP - JavaScript/TypeScript framework
- MCP Framework - Elegant TypeScript framework
- Foxy Contexts - Golang library for declarative server creation
The Future of MCP Integration
As the Model Context Protocol ecosystem continues to grow, we can expect:
- More specialized servers for niche applications and industries
- Enhanced security features for enterprise-grade implementations
- Standardized tooling for easier server development and maintenance
- Integration platforms that unify access to multiple MCP servers
- AI-native applications built specifically to leverage MCP capabilities
Conclusion: Transforming AI with Contextual Intelligence
The extensive collection of MCP servers available today represents a fundamental shift in how we interact with AI systems. By connecting language models to external tools and data sources through the Model Context Protocol, we transform them from isolated text generators into capable agents that can meaningfully interact with the digital world.
Whether you're enhancing development workflows, automating data analysis, managing cloud infrastructure, or building entirely new AI-powered applications, MCP servers provide the critical bridge between AI's reasoning capabilities and real-world systems.
As you explore the servers in this guide, consider how these integrations might enhance your specific use cases. The true power of MCP lies in combining multiple servers to create workflows that were previously impossible with traditional AI interfaces.
By implementing these MCP servers today, you're not just adopting a new technology—you're embracing an entirely new paradigm for AI interaction that will fundamentally change how we work with intelligent systems.